HE’S used to filming in exotic locations with sandy white beaches, palm trees and crystal-clear water. But the best perk of Nico Panagio’s job as host of Survivor South Africa is exploring the tropical islands where the show is filmed with his family in tow.
This time around, however, things were a little different. Two weeks before filming was set to begin for the new season of the show, the country went into lockdown and all travel ground to a halt.
Nico, who’s back on our screens presenting Survivor SA: Immunity Island, says he wasn’t sure the reality show would go ahead because of the pandemic.
